2011-03-26 106 views
1

我該如何讓這個「/ \」出現在我的解釋器樹中?ANTLR中的轉義反斜槓

expression 
    : boolean_expression (('/\'' | '\'/') boolean_expression)* 
    ; 

我已經設法通過放上'\'/'來解決\ /,如你所見。並打印\/ 但\ \不工作。

在你問,這是一個項目,我必須使用這些符號。

回答

2

這是你的意思嗎?

expression 
     : boolean_expression ((UP | DOWN) boolean_expression)* 
     ; 

    boolean_expression 
     : 'true' | 'false' 

     ; 


    UP : '/''\\' ; 


    DOWN : '\\''/'; 
+0

是啊! thx隊友! – pantelis 2011-03-26 01:25:51